  • How can one  read a Excel File and Upload into Table using Pl/SQL Code.

    How can one read a Excel File and Upload into Table using Pl/SQL Code.
    1. Excel File is on My PC.
    2. And I want to write a Stored Procedure or Package to do that.
    3. DataBase is on Other Server. Client-Server Environment.
    4. I am Using Toad or PlSql developer tool.

    If you would like to create a package/procedure in order to solve this problem consider using the UTL_FILE in built package, here are a few steps to get you going:
    1. Get your DBA to create directory object in oracle using the following command:
    create directory TEST_DIR as ‘directory_path’;
    Note: This directory is on the server.
    2. Grant read,write on directory directory_object_name to username;
    You can find out the directory_object_name value from dba_directories view if you are using the system user account.
    3. Logon as the user as mentioned above.
    Sample code read plain text file code, you can modify this code to suit your need (i.e. read a csv file)
    function getData(p_filename in varchar2,
    p_filepath in varchar2
    ) RETURN VARCHAR2 is
    input_file utl_file.file_type;
    --declare a buffer to read text data
    input_buffer varchar2(4000);
    begin
    --using the UTL_FILE in built package
    input_file := utl_file.fopen(p_filepath, p_filename, 'R');
    utl_file.get_line(input_file, input_buffer);
    --debug
    --dbms_output.put_line(input_buffer);
    utl_file.fclose(input_file);
    --return data
    return input_buffer;
    end;
    Hope this helps.

  • How To read lib*.so files and verbose its content

    Hi
    Is there any command with which we can read shared library files and see whats its contents are i.e. whats are the functions available inside it and how its control flow.
    Regards
    Jeet

    I know of none that shows flow control but you can do a man against nm(1) to see what is in the library (nm libc.so.1).

  • How to Read the "text file and csv file" through powershell Scripts

    Hi All
    i need to add a multiple users in a particular Group through powershell Script how to read the text and CSV files in powershell
    am completly new to Powershell scripts any one pls respond ASAP.with step by step process pls
    Regards:
    Rajeshreddy.k

    Hi Rajeshreddy.k,
    To add multiple users to one group, I wouldn't use a .csv file since the only value you need from a list is the users to be added.
    To start create a list of users that should be added to the group, import this list in a variable called $users, the group distinguishedName in a variable called $Group and simply call the ActiveDirectory cmdlet Add-GroupMember.
    $Users = Get-Content -Path 'C:\ListOfUsernames.txt'
    $Group = 'CN=MyGroup,OU=MyOrg,DC=domain,DC=lcl'
    Add-ADGroupMember -Identity $Group -Members $Users

  • Need a VB-Script that read a txt-file and only the lines that are new since last time

    Hi,
    I need help to write a VB script that read all new lines since the last time.
    For example:  The script reads the textfile at specific time, then 10 minutes later the script read the file again, and it should now only read the lines that are new since last time. Anyone that has such a script in your scriptingbox?
    cheers!
    DocHo
    Doc

    Based on the excellent idea by Pegasus, where is a VBScript solution. I use a separate file to save the last line count read from the file, then each time the file is read I update the line count. Only lines after the last count are output by the program:
    Option Explicit
    Dim strFile, objFSO, objFile, strCountFile, objCountFile, strLine, lngCount, lngLine
    Const ForReading = 1
    Const ForWriting = 2
    Const OpenAsASCII = 0
    Const CreateIfNotExist = True
    ' Specify input file to be read.
    strFile = "c:\Scripts\Example.log"
    ' Specify file with most recent line count.
    strCountFile = "c:\Scripts\Count.txt"
    ' Open the input file for reading.
    Set objFSO = CreateObject("Scripting.FileSystemObject")
    Set objFile = objFSO.OpenTextFile(strFile, ForReading)
    ' Check if the line count file exists.
    If (objFSO.FileExists(strCountFile) = False) Then
        ' Initial count is 0, so all lines are read.
        lngCount = 0
    Else
        ' Open the line count file.
        Set objCountFile = objFSO.OpenTextFile(strCountFile, ForReading)
        ' Read the most recent line count.
        Do Until objCountFile.AtEndOfStream
            lngCount = CLng(objCountFile.ReadLine)
        Loop
    End If
    ' Read the input file.
    lngLine = 0
    Do Until objFile.AtEndOfStream
        ' Count lines.
        lngLine = lngLine + 1
        strLine = objFile.ReadLine
        If (lngLine >= lngCount) Then
            ' Output the line.
            Wscript.Echo strLine
        End If
    Loop
    ' Close all files.
    objFile.Close
    If (lngCount > 0) Then
        objCountFile.Close
    End If
    ' Ignore last line of the file if it is blank.
    If (strLine = "") Then
        lngLine = lngLine - 1
    End If
    ' Save the new line count.
    Set objCountFile = objFSO.OpenTextFile(strCountFile, _
        ForWriting, CreateIfNotExist, OpenAsASCII)
    objCountFile.WriteLine CStr(lngLine + 1)
    objCountFile.Close
    Richard Mueller - MVP Directory Services
